Washington-like McNugget sells on eBay

A Nebraska woman has sold a McDonald's Chicken McNugget resembling George Washington for more than £5,000 on eBay.
Rebekah Speight, of Dakota City, sold the three-year-old McNugget to raise money for a children's charity.
Mrs Speight says her children didn't eat their chicken nuggets during a McDonald's visit three years ago.
She was about to bin the food, then spotted Washington's resemblance and decided to freeze it instead.
eBay temporarily removed her auction last month because it violated rules regulating expired food.
But Mrs Speight later received an email saying the site was "willing to make exceptions to help your cause".
It eventually sold for $8,100 which will go towards sending 50 children to a summer church camp.
